Is 366 027 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 366 027 is about 605.002.

Thus, the square root of 366 027 is not an integer, and therefore 366 027 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 366 027?

The square of a number (here 366 027) is the result of the product of this number (366 027) by itself (i.e., 366 027 × 366 027); the square of 366 027 is sometimes called "raising 366 027 to the power 2", or "366 027 squared".

The square of 366 027 is 133 975 764 729 because 366 027 × 366 027 = 366 0272 = 133 975 764 729.

As a consequence, 366 027 is the square root of 133 975 764 729.
